This is made using all colours from the Subtles colour collection. Papers, ribbons and inks. 


I have gone for my first effort at a 'shabby chic' style card...not sure if it passes...what do you think? I sanded the edges of all the paper elements and used Core'dinations cardstock for the butterflies.


I added an Antique Brad as a finishing touch. Overall I think it's certainly a pretty card, if not quite Shabby Chic!

Here is a card I made yesterday using some stamps I don't use very often, but I really should as they are lovely!


I have used Summer Afternoon Hostess set and stamped it in Soft Suede. I coloured theimage with River Rock, Wild Wasabi and Crumb Cake for a soft look. The papers are from the Subtles Designer Series Paper and I stitched the top of the card for a change...getting adventurous now that I know I can do it lol! I finished some paper piercing around the image and an antique brad. I left it without a sentiment as I couldn't decide on one lol!
